Iowa expands ban on teaching gender and sexuality in grades 7–12, facing legal and ethical challenges.
Iowa lawmakers advanced a bill to expand a ban on teaching gender identity and sexual orientation to students in grades 7–12, building on a 2023 law covering kindergarten through sixth grade.
The legislation, Senate File 2003, applies to public, charter, and innovation zone schools and faces legal challenges over constitutional rights.
Opponents argue it harms LGBTQ students and limits education, while supporters cite parental rights and age-appropriateness.
Meanwhile, Michigan faces a separate debate over a bill requiring legislative approval for future education standards, following the adoption of inclusive health guidelines.
